بکندباز
این تمرین با ابزار chatgpt ساخته شده است. در صورتی که اشکالی در متن سوال یا تست ها مشاهده می کنید لطفاً از طریق تب "نظرات" اعلام کنید.

یک لیست از اعداد صحیح داده شده است. می خواهیم این اعداد را به گونه ای مرتب کنیم که اعداد فرد در ابتدا قرار بگیرند و سپس اعداد زوج. این فرایند را به صورت نزولی بر اساس مقدار هر عدد انجام دهید.

نمونه ورودی و خروجی

OddEvenSort([3, 6, 8, 2, 5, 4, 7]) ➞ [7, 5, 3, 8, 6, 4, 2]

OddEvenSort([11, 14, 18, 27, 22, 16]) ➞ [27, 11, 22, 18, 16, 14]

OddEvenSort([1, 3, 5, 7, 2, 4, 6, 8]) ➞ [7, 5, 3, 1, 8, 6, 4, 2]
OddEvenSort([3, 6, 8, 2, 5, 4, 7])  ➞ [7, 5, 3, 8, 6, 4, 2]
OddEvenSort([11, 14, 18, 27, 22, 16])  ➞ [27, 11, 22, 18, 16, 14]
OddEvenSort([1, 3, 5, 7, 2, 4, 6, 8])  ➞ [7, 5, 3, 1, 8, 6, 4, 2]

هنوز پاسخی برای این تمرین ثبت نشده است

نظرات

*
*